Monthly Tool Talk - Symbaloo
Symbaloo can be used as a Personal Learning Environment (PLE) for students. Symbaloo is a website where you can store all of your bookmarks online, so that you can have quick access to them. It stores them all into one convenient place. You can create what they call webmixes, by topic or use, for a unit study, or links to different types of media such as WebQuests and videos, that you want your students to visit. There are free versions of Symbaloo and SymbalooEDU.
